About Oberoi Cecil

  • Close Panel 

The Oberoi Cecil was built in 1884 and is a fine colonial-style building within walking distance of the Vice Regal Lodge, the former summer residence of the Viceroy of India, in the heart of the hill station of Shimla. It was extensively renovated in 1997 and is now a stunning hotel, combining colonial grandeur and modern comforts.

The 79 rooms are decorated with period features, and most have valley or mountain views. All have en-suite bathroom stocked with deluxe Ayurvedic toiletries. Other amenities include television, DVD player, internet access and bar. There is 24 hour room service.

The main restaurant serves European and Asian cuisine in a grand setting, complete with wooden panelling and chandeliers. The Cedar Garden provides al fresco drinks and snacks between 11am and 3pm, while the Tea Lounge and Bar is in the Atrium Lobby and is open till 11pm.

The Spa
A full range of health and pampering treatments is offered here, which can be experienced while enjoying views of the mountains. Various types of massage, including Thai, aimed at releasing stress and tension, and hot lava shells for warmth and deep relaxation can be combined with soothing body wraps and exfoliating scrubs to provide a complete spa treatment. Manicures, pedicures and facials are also popular and there are also treatments designed specifically for men. Ayurvedic therapies are a speciality.
There is a heated indoor swimming pool with large picture windows offering views of the valley and mountains. This is one of the highest swimming pools in the world, some 7,000 feet above sea level.

Indoor recreational facilities include billiards, board games and a children's toy room. Guests can take nature walks or guided treks or explore the area on horseback. Golf is also available nearby. Located at the western end of the mall, Shimla's main street, the hotel is within easy walking distance of the sights of the town.

Pricing guidelines for India

  • Open Panel 

We hope the following will give you a rough idea of costs. These are quoted per person based on twin share for two people, without international flights but including internal flights. We’ve used good standard accommodation throughout. There are nearly always ways to spend more money than we’ve suggested (!), but these prices show a good and realistic range for each type of trip.

International flights will add from about £450 to £700 depending on the season and route (unless the airlines have special offers). India combines well with Nepal.
